The Xavier Musketeer men's basketball coaches and staff and a pair of key players are among those receiving high honors in The Almanac, the annual college basketball season preview produced by The Field of 68 staff that comes out this week.
 
Xavier sophomore guard Desmond Claude earned a spot on the BIG EAST Conference Second Team, while senior guard Dayvion McKnight was named BIG EAST Preseason Newcomer of the Year.

A panel of anonymous BIG EAST coaches also tabbed McKnight as a breakout star and named Sean Miller and his staff the best development staff in the league. (Editor’s note: Miller’s staff includes former McClain High School and XU standout Dante Jackson, who is in his sixth year as an assistant coach.)
 

Claude, who was selected to the 2023 BIG EAST All-Freshman Team by the league coaches, played a more and more significant role on XU's veteran team as the season progressed. Three of Claude's five double-figure scoring games came in the last five games of the season, including 11 points in the NCAA Second Round win over Pittsburgh.
 
McKnight, who transferred to Xavier from Western Kentucky, earned All-Conference USA honors each of the last three seasons. He ranked fifth in C-USA in scoring last season at 16.5 ppg., seventh in in assists at 3.8 apg., sixth in in steals at 1.9 spg. and 20th in rebounds at 5.0 rpg.
